newsletter no.16 - aug 2007 - Work Experience Students help out at National Trust

My Name is Christy Joshua; I am currently a year 12 Academic student at Prince Andrew School.   This year I finished my AS level courses which were; AS Biology, AS Environment Management, and AS Computing, alongside this I also studied GCSE Business Studies.  I hope to pass these AS course and to go back to study further in the next school year. For the next school year the subjects I would like to study are Biology, Chemistry, Literature and Business Studies.  
Doing work experience at the National Trust Office is something I’ve always enjoyed.  There is always something new to learn about our island.  Not only is there always something to do in the office, but there is also the opportunity to do field work.  I also visited the archives which is fascinating.  I hope doing work experience, will give me an in-sight into which job I would like to do in the future.  I found working at the National Trust interesting, as it helps to build on my current knowledge. I look forward to doing work experience at the National Trust in the near future.
